Wood-mizer LT70 Specifications

General IconGeneral
Log HandlingHydraulic
Cutting SpeedVariable, depends on wood type and blade
OperationHydraulic
Max Log Diameter36" (91 cm)
Max Log Length21' 4" (6.5 m)
Weight6, 800 lbs (3084 kg)
